The PVA3A501A01R00 is a trimming potentiometer from Murata Electronics. It's designed for precise voltage or current adjustment in electronic circuits. This component offers high stability and reliability, making it suitable for a wide range of applications requiring fine-tuning capabilities.
Applications
- Calibration Circuits: Used for calibrating electronic equipment such as sensors, measuring instruments, and power supplies.
- Gain Adjustment: Employed in amplifier circuits to adjust the gain.
- Offset Adjustment: Used to adjust the offset voltage or current in electronic circuits.
- Frequency Tuning: Found in oscillator circuits and filters to adjust the frequency.
- Brightness Control: Used in display circuits to control the brightness of LEDs or LCDs.
- Volume Control: Used in audio circuits to adjust the volume.
